Tip 1: Choose the Right Vehicle Category for Your Actual Needs
One of the most common and costly mistakes people make when renting a car monthly is selecting a vehicle category that does not match their real requirements.
It is easy to be tempted by a larger or more premium model, but the monthly price difference between categories is significant. An economy hatchback will typically cost considerably less per month than a mid-size SUV, and for someone using the car primarily for daily city commuting, the extra size and power of an SUV adds no practical value.
A simple guide to choosing the right category:
- Economy cars: Best for solo commuters and budget-conscious renters who primarily drive within the city
- Sedans: Ideal for professionals and small families who need a balance of comfort and running costs
- Mid-size SUVs: Suited for families, frequent highway driving, or those who regularly travel between emirates
- Luxury and premium vehicles: Best reserved for corporate use or special occasions rather than everyday monthly use
Matching your vehicle category to your actual lifestyle needs is one of the simplest ways to reduce your monthly rental spend without compromising on quality.
Tip 2: Book in Advance to Avoid Seasonal Price Increases
Dubai experiences a well-defined tourist and residency season that directly affects car rental pricing. The peak months, running from November through to March, bring significantly higher demand for rental vehicles across the city. During this period, monthly rates rise noticeably and vehicle availability becomes more limited.
Booking your monthly rental several weeks ahead of your required start date allows you to lock in more competitive pricing before seasonal demand pushes rates upward. It also gives you access to a wider selection of vehicles, which means you are more likely to find the exact model and category you need at the price point you want.
If your plans allow some flexibility on start dates, even shifting your rental commencement by a week or two can make a measurable difference to your monthly cost.

Tip 4: Understand Exactly What is Included in Your Package
Not all monthly rental packages are structured the same way, and failing to read the terms carefully before booking can lead to unexpected costs that significantly inflate your total spend.
Before confirming any monthly rental, make sure you have clear answers to the following questions:
- Is basic insurance included, and what does it cover?
- Is routine maintenance and servicing included?
- What is the monthly mileage limit, and what are the charges for exceeding it?
- Is roadside assistance available around the clock?
- Is there a security deposit, and how and when is it refunded?
- Are there any delivery or collection charges?
Understanding the full cost structure of your rental before signing protects you from hidden charges and allows you to make a genuinely accurate cost comparison between different vehicles and packages. Tip 6: Prepare Your Documents Before You Book
This tip is practical rather than financial, but it has a direct impact on cost efficiency. Delays caused by missing or incorrect documentation can push back your rental start date, which in some cases leads to additional expenses or the loss of a preferred vehicle.
UAE residents require:
- Valid Emirates ID
- UAE driving licence
Tourists and visitors require:
- Valid passport
- International Driving Permit (IDP) where applicable
- A recognised foreign driving licence
Having all of your documentation prepared and ready before you begin the booking process means your rental can be confirmed and collected without unnecessary delays.
Tip 7: Consider Renting During the Off-Peak Season
If your schedule allows flexibility on timing, renting during Dubai’s off-peak months broadly from June through to August can deliver meaningful savings on monthly rental rates.
During the summer months, tourist numbers drop significantly and overall rental demand decreases across the city. Rental providers respond to this reduced demand with more competitive pricing, which means drivers who can time their rental to coincide with the quieter season can often secure notably better rates than they would find during peak winter months.
For those who live and work in Dubai year-round, this is particularly relevant when planning ahead for a new rental period.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is monthly car rental cheaper than daily rental in Dubai?
Yes. When the total cost is spread across 30 days, monthly rentals consistently deliver a lower per-day rate than daily or weekly hire options often significantly so.
Can tourists rent a car monthly in the UAE?
Yes. Tourists with a valid passport, recognised driving licence, and International Driving Permit where required are eligible for monthly rental across the UAE.
Does monthly car rental in Dubai include insurance?
Most monthly rental packages include basic insurance coverage. The exact terms vary between vehicles and providers, so confirming what is included before booking is always advisable.
What documents do UAE residents need for monthly car hire?
UAE residents need a valid Emirates ID and a current UAE driving licence to complete the rental process.
How far in advance should I book a monthly rental in Dubai?
Booking two to four weeks ahead is generally recommended, particularly during the peak season months of November through March when demand and prices are at their highest.
